Featured on "Diners, Drive-Ins & Dives" on the Food Network, The Thumb is no ordinary gas station. Recognized statewide for its award-winning barbecue, most people don't know an amazing bakery also exists in the same building.

You’ll find The Thumb at 9393 East Bell Rd., Scottsdale, AZ 85260. Bakery hours are 6 a.m. to 8 p.m. on Monday through Thursday and 6 a.m. to 9 p.m. on Saturday & Sunday.
